How to uninstall FXCM Trading Station from your PC

This page contains thorough information on how to remove FXCM Trading Station for Windows. It is made by FXCM. More info about FXCM can be read here. The program is frequently found in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Candleworks\FXTS2 folder. Take into account that this path can differ being determined by the user's choice. The program's main executable file is labeled FXTSpp.exe and occupies 184.00 KB (188416 bytes).

FXCM Trading Station is comprised of the following executables which occupy 1.91 MB (2007040 bytes) on disk:

  • EmailConfigurator.exe (212.00 KB)
  • FXSettings.exe (288.00 KB)
  • FXTSpp.exe (184.00 KB)
  • fxupdater.exe (1.05 MB)
  • PackageInstaller.exe (92.00 KB)
  • tststs.exe (45.50 KB)
  • XRep.exe (58.50 KB)
